Output 50068013b625818a07ea04f5c71c34305033ae974c1831d5aeeeeeaa60640553:23

value
763
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63fbef6dc22649444f655d5f78f5035eb70af66c96363b30788f5d8966bd6b9a
address
bc1pv0a77mwzyey5gnm9t40h3agrt6ms4anvjcmrkvrc3awcje4adwdq35kwkw
transaction
50068013b625818a07ea04f5c71c34305033ae974c1831d5aeeeeeaa60640553
spent
true